[Linux操作系统]云端启航,Linux云开发环境的构建与实践|linux平台开发环境,Linux 云开发环境

PikPak安卓最新版APP v1.46.2_免费会员兑换邀请码【508001】可替代115网盘_全平台支持Windows和苹果iOS&Mac_ipad_iphone -云主机博士 第1张

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]NexGenAI - 您的智能助手,最低价体验ChatGPT Plus共享账号

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

Linux操作系统云端启航,Linux云开发环境的构建与实践"专题聚焦于Linux平台开发环境的云端构建与实践应用。内容涵盖Linux云开发环境的搭建流程、关键工具与技术,以及实际开发中的最佳实践。通过云端部署,提升开发效率与灵活性,为开发者提供高效、稳定的Linux云开发解决方案,助力项目快速迭代与创新。

本文目录导读:

  1. Linux云开发环境概述
  2. 构建Linux云开发环境的关键步骤
  3. Linux云开发环境的优势
  4. Linux云开发环境的应用实践
  5. 常见问题及解决方案
  6. 未来展望

随着云计算技术的迅猛发展,开发者们逐渐告别了传统的本地开发模式,迎来了云开发的新时代,在这个时代中,Linux作为开源界的翘楚,以其高效、稳定、可定制性强的特点,成为了云开发环境的首选,本文将深入探讨Linux云开发环境的构建、优势及其在实际开发中的应用。

Linux云开发环境概述

Linux云开发环境是指基于云计算平台,利用Linux操作系统提供的开发工具和资源,进行软件开发、测试、部署的全流程环境,这种环境不仅提供了强大的计算能力和存储资源,还通过虚拟化技术实现了资源的动态分配和弹性扩展。

构建Linux云开发环境的关键步骤

1、选择合适的云服务平台

不同的云服务平台提供的功能和价格各异,选择时应综合考虑性能、安全性、服务支持等因素,常见的云服务平台有阿里云、腾讯云、华为云等。

2、创建虚拟机实例

在云平台上创建Linux虚拟机实例,选择合适的CPU、内存、存储配置,以保障开发环境的性能需求。

3、安装和配置Linux操作系统

根据开发需求选择合适的Linux发行版,如Ubuntu、CentOS等,并进行系统优化和必要的软件安装。

4、部署开发工具和依赖库

安装开发所需的编译器、调试工具、代码管理工具等,并配置相应的开发环境。

5、设置安全和网络策略

配置防火墙规则、安全组策略,确保开发环境的安全性和网络连通性。

Linux云开发环境的优势

1、高效性

Linux系统的高效性体现在其强大的命令行工具和脚本支持,能够大幅提升开发效率。

2、稳定性

Linux系统的稳定性有目共睹,即使在长时间高负载的情况下也能保持良好的运行状态。

3、可定制性

开发者可以根据需求灵活定制开发环境,安装所需的软件包和工具。

4、成本效益

云开发环境按需付费,避免了本地硬件设备的巨额投入和维护成本。

5、协作便利

云开发环境支持多人协作,团队成员可以实时共享代码和资源,提高开发协同性。

Linux云开发环境的应用实践

1、Web应用开发

利用Linux云开发环境,可以快速搭建Web服务器,进行前后端分离开发,部署高效稳定的Web应用。

2、大数据处理

Linux云开发环境提供了强大的数据处理能力,适用于大数据分析和机器学习等场景。

3、移动应用开发

通过云开发环境,可以跨平台进行移动应用的编译、测试和发布,提升开发效率。

4、游戏开发

利用Linux云开发环境的高性能计算资源,进行游戏引擎的编译和游戏测试,优化游戏性能。

常见问题及解决方案

1、网络延迟问题

选择离用户群体近的云服务节点,优化网络路由,减少网络延迟。

2、安全风险

定期更新系统补丁,配置强密码策略,启用多因素认证,增强安全性。

3、性能瓶颈

监控系统性能,及时调整资源配置,使用负载均衡技术分散请求压力。

未来展望

随着云计算技术的不断进步,Linux云开发环境将更加智能化、自动化,未来的云开发环境将更加注重用户体验,提供更加便捷的开发工具和服务,助力开发者高效完成项目。

Linux云开发环境以其独特的优势,正在成为开发者们的首选,通过合理构建和优化,开发者可以充分利用云计算的强大能力,提升开发效率,降低成本,实现更高的项目价值,在这个云时代,Linux云开发环境无疑是开发者们云端启航的最佳选择。

相关关键词

Linux, 云开发, 云计算, 虚拟机, Ubuntu, CentOS, 开发工具, 安全策略, 网络配置, 高效性, 稳定性, 可定制性, 成本效益, 协作, Web应用, 大数据, 移动应用, 游戏开发, 网络延迟, 安全风险, 性能瓶颈, 云服务, 负载均衡, 系统优化, 脚本支持, 编译器, 调试工具, 代码管理, 防火墙, 安全组, 资源分配, 弹性扩展, 开源, 云平台, 阿里云, 腾讯云, 华为云, 虚拟化, 系统补丁, 多因素认证, 性能监控, 自动化, 智能化, 用户体验, 开发效率, 成本降低, 项目价值, 云时代, 开发者, 云端启航

Vultr justhost.asia racknerd hostkvm pesyun


iproyal.png
原文链接:,转发请注明来源!